On offer: an original (i.e. not a later reproduction) antique map "DENBIGH Comitatus pars Olim Ordovicum." A very attractive and detailed early 17th Century map of Denbighshire.  Offered with later hand colouring.
   

DATE PRINTED: 1610 or 1637 editions from the plate first published in 1607.  The absence of text on the back indicates this is not from the 1607 edition.  Denbigh was never engraved with a plate number so the 1610 and 1637 issues are identical.  Noted in pencil as being from the 1637 edition.

SIZE: The printed area is approximately 32.5 x 27 cm (12.75 x 10.75 inches), plus good margins and a centre fold as issued.

ARTIST/CARTOGRAPHER/ENGRAVER: Engraved by William Kip based on the earlier Saxton maps. Kip was a Goldsmith and engraver, especially of maps.  

PROVENANCE: Produced for the 1607 edition of William Camden’s “Britannia”.  William Camden (2 May 1551 – 9 November 1623) was an English antiquarian, historian, topographer, and herald, best known as author of Britannia, the first chorographical survey of the islands of Great Britain and Ireland, and the Annales, the first detailed historical account of the reign of Elizabeth I of England.  The 1607 latin edition of Britannia included for the first time a full set of English county maps, based on the surveys of Christopher Saxton and John Norden, and engraved by William Kip and William Hole (who also engraved the fine frontispiece).  The maps would be reprinted in the English editions of the Britannia, 1610 and 1637.
